The client has fallen off his mountain bike and sustained multiple abrasions to both of his knees. Which would be appropriate medication(s) for pain management for this client? (Select All That Apply)
Acetaminophen
Aspirin
Hydrocodone
Ibuprofen
Morphine
Correct Answer : A,D
A. Acetaminophen
Acetaminophen is a non-opioid analgesic that can be used for mild to moderate pain relief. It is suitable for managing pain associated with abrasions.
B. Aspirin
Aspirin is a nonsteroidal anti-inflammatory drug (NSAID) with analgesic and anti-inflammatory properties. While it can be used for pain relief, it may increase the risk of bleeding, and its use is generally avoided in acute injuries with bleeding.
C. Hydrocodone
Hydrocodone is an opioid analgesic and is typically reserved for moderate to severe pain. It may not be the first choice for managing pain associated with abrasions unless the pain is more intense.
D. Ibuprofen
Ibuprofen is a NSAID that provides analgesic and anti-inflammatory effects. It is suitable for managing pain and inflammation associated with abrasions.
E. Morphine
Morphine is a strong opioid analgesic and is generally reserved for severe pain, such as post-surgical pain or pain associated with more significant injuries. It may be excessive for managing pain from abrasions.
